Santander railway station, also known as Santander ADIF to distinguish it from the Santander Feve station (note both are currently owned by Adif) is the main railway station of the Spanish city of Santander, Cantabria. It opened in 1858 and served over 3 million passengers in 2018. The station is actually a complex of two stations, one serving Iberian-gauge railways, and another adjacent serving metre-gauge services to Bilbao-Abando and Oviedo.
